What is a flap disc? The discs are made up of many. Flap discs were developed as an alternative to resin bonded grinding wheels and fiber discs. Flap discs are an abrasive product that are used on angle grinders for grinding, blending, and finishing, as well as removing rust, paint and weld seams.
